A Brief History of CaixaForum Madrid
CaixaForum Madrid opened its doors in 2008, transforming a historic power station into a modern cultural center. The building itself is a work of art, designed by Herzog & de Meuron, the architects behind iconic structures like the Tate Modern in London. The Vertical Garden
One of the first things you’ll notice as you approach CaixaForum Madrid is its striking vertical garden. Designed by botanist Patrick Blanc, this lush green wall spans over 24 meters and features around 15,000 plants from 250 different species. It’s not only a visual delight but also a symbol of the harmonious blend of nature and urban life.
Diverse Exhibitions
CaixaForum Madrid is renowned for its diverse range of exhibitions. From classical art to modern installations, there’s something for everyone. The center hosts temporary exhibitions that rotate throughout the year, ensuring that each visit offers a new experience. Recent exhibitions have included works by renowned artists such as Dalí, Rodin, and Warhol, as well as thematic displays focusing on topics like ancient civilizations and contemporary photography.

Planning Your Visit
When planning your visit to CaixaForum Madrid, it’s helpful to know that the center is conveniently located near several other major attractions, including the Prado Museum and the Royal Botanic Garden. Its central location makes it easy to include CaixaForum in a day of exploring Madrid’s cultural treasures.
